The ARRT MRI credential is a post-primary certification — candidates must already hold ARRT certification and registration (or an NMTCB/ARDMS equivalent) in a supporting discipline: Radiography, Nuclear Medicine Technology, Radiation Therapy, or Sonography. Beyond the primary credential, ARRT requires 16 hours of structured MRI-specific education completed within the 2 years before applying, documented clinical experience through 125 procedure repetitions across ARRT's required categories, and continued compliance with ARRT's Standards of Ethics. The exam fee is $225 if your supporting credential was issued by ARRT itself, or $450 if it was issued by NMTCB or ARDMS. The computer-based exam consists of 200 scored multiple-choice questions (plus roughly 30 unscored pilot items mixed in) across four content domains — Patient Care, Safety, Image Production, and Procedures — administered in a 230-minute appointment window that includes the tutorial. The scaled passing score is 75 on ARRT's 1–99 scale.
